>   Cluster filesystems are amazing if you need them, and to be avoided if
> at all possible. The overhead from the cluster locking hurts performance
> quite a lot, and adds a non-trivial layer of complexity.

Yes, that's the true challenge. It's sad that NFS might provide better
performance than a cluster filesystem will.

> 
>   I say this as someone who has used dual-primary DRBD with GFS2 for
> many years.
> 
>   To expand on why you can't use something like ext4; Non-cluster-aware
> file systems expect all changes to the backing device to go through it.
> So there's no mechanism to tell the FS on one node that blocks have
> changed because of actions on another node. Likewise, they have no
> mechanism to coordinate sane and safe access to blocks. These mechanisms
> are exactly what makes a cluster FS what it is.

>>         ext4 can only be mounted on one node at a time. If you need to
>>         access
>>         files on both nodes at the same time than a cluster filesystem
>>         should
>>         be used (GFS2, OCFS2).
